Definitions:

Sociocultural

Relating to the combined influence of social and cultural factors on an individual or group's behavior and attitudes.

Psychodynamic

A psychological method focusing on the detailed examination of the underlying psychological dynamics influencing human actions, emotions, and sentiments, and their connection to early life experiences.

Generalized Anxiety Disorders

A mental health disorder characterized by excessive, uncontrollable worry about everyday things, affecting daily functioning.

DSM-5 Diagnosis

is the process of identifying mental disorders using the fifth edition of the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, a standardized classification system.
